Abstract :
The aim of this study was to evaluate and compare changes of arterial blood pressure, heart rate and thoracic impedance cardiography parameters during head-up tilt table test and to discuss possible negative-positive influence to diagnostic contribution. Results demonstrate that blood pressure parameters do not drop dramatically while tilting within healthy subjects. On the contrary, thoracic impedance cardiography parameters reflect supposed changes in hemodynamic system, primarily the decrease of stroke volume.
